Brief summary
The purpose of this study is to assess how well JNJ-95597528 works when compared to placebo in adult participants with moderate to severe asthma (long-term condition that affects the airways in your lungs).
Interventions
JNJ-95597528 will be administered as subcutaneous (SC) injection.
Placebo will be administered as SC injection.

Eligibility
Inclusion criteria
* Medically stable on the basis of physical examination, medical history, and vital signs performed at screening or at baseline * Confirmed variable expiratory flow (1 or more of the following) per global initiative for asthma (GINA) 2025 at the baseline visit: a. Evidence of bronchodilator responsiveness at screening and baseline: Post-bronchodilator forced expiratory volume in 1 second (FEV1) increases by greater than or equal to (\>=) 200 milliliter (mL) and \>=12 percent (%) of pre- bronchodilator value, or increase in peak expiratory flow (PEF) \>=20%, if spirometry is not available; b. Demonstrated increase in lung function within the past 3 years after \>=4 weeks of daily inhaled corticosteroids (ICS)-containing treatment, shown by: increase from baseline FEV1 by \>=12% and \>=200 mL, or increase in PEF by \>=20%; c. Positive bronchial provocation test within the past 3 years, as defined by: \>=20% decrease from baseline in FEV1 with standard doses of methacholine, or \>=15% decrease from baseline in FEV1 with standardized hyperventilation, hypertonic saline or mannitol challenge, or decrease from baseline in FEV1 of \>10% and \>200 mL with standardized exercise challenge * Inhaled corticosteroid: Prescribed medium- or high-dose ICS for at least 1 year and a stable dose of medium- or high-dose ICS for at least 3 months prior to the screening visit per GINA 2025: • High-dose ICS is defined as a total daily dose \>=500 microgram (mcg) fluticasone propionate or equivalent, • Medium-dose ICS is defined as a total daily dose \>=250 to 500 mcg fluticasone propionate or equivalent * Additional controller medication: Must be on a stable dose of at least 1 additional maintenance asthma controller, in addition to ICS, per GINA 2025, for at least 3 months prior to screening (for example, long-acting beta-agonist \[LABA\], long-acting muscarinic antagonist \[LAMA\] \[can be combined with ICS in 1 inhaler or can be separate inhalers\], leukotriene receptor antagonist \[LTRA\]) * Asthma control questionnaire, 5-item (ACQ-5) score \>=1.5 at the screening visit and the baseline visit
Exclusion criteria
* History of uncontrolled, significant renal, cardiac, vascular, pulmonary (other than asthma), gastrointestinal, endocrine, neurologic, hematologic, rheumatologic, psychiatric, or metabolic disturbances that makes the participant unsuitable for the trial per investigator judgment * Any clinically important pulmonary disease other than asthma or pulmonary or systemic diseases, other than asthma, that are associated with elevated peripheral eosinophil counts * Experienced primary efficacy failure (no response within 16 weeks) or an adverse event (AE) requiring discontinuation related to agents inhibiting interleukin (IL)-13, IL-4Rα, and IL-4 signaling * Participants with either of the following events within the 2 weeks prior to the screening visit: a. Treatment with systemic steroids (oral or parenteral) for worsening asthma, b. Hospitalization or an emergency medical care visit for worsening asthma * Current smokers or former smokers with a smoking history \>=20 pack-years. Former smokers must have stopped smoking within 6 months of the screening visit. This includes participants using vaping products and e-cigarettes
Design outcomes
Primary
| Measure | Time frame | Description |
|---|---|---|
| Number of Asthma Exacerbations Through Week 48 | Up to Week 48 | Participant who experiences intercurrent events (ICEs) in categories 5 or 6 after treatment initiation and prior to Week 48 is considered to have an asthma exacerbation. An asthma exacerbation is defined as a worsening of asthma that requires a medical intervention and/or results in death. A worsening of asthma is defined as: worsening of asthma signs/symptoms; increased use of 'as needed' reliever medication; deterioration of lung function that is, peak expiratory flow, forced expiratory volume in 1 second (FEV1). |
Secondary
| Measure | Time frame | Description |
|---|---|---|
| Time to First Asthma Exacerbation Event From Week 0 Through Week 48 | From Week 0 Through Week 48 | Time to first asthma exacerbation event from Week 0 through Week 48 will be reported. A participant is considered to have an asthma exacerbation if the participant experiences ICEs in categories 5 or 6 after treatment initiation and prior to Week 48. |
| Change From Baseline in Pre-Bronchodilator Forced Expiratory Volume in 1 Second (FEV1) at Weeks 2, 12, 24, and 48 | Baseline, Week 2, 12, 24, and 48 | Change from baseline in pre-bronchodilator FEV1 at Weeks 2, 12, 24, and 48, where a participant experiencing ICEs in categories 5 or 6 after treatment initiation and prior to Week 48 is considered to have a zero change from baseline in pre-BD FEV1 at Weeks 2, 12, 24, and 48 will be reported. |
| Change from Baseline in Fractional Exhaled Nitric Oxide (FeNO) at Weeks 2, 12, 24, and 48 | Baseline, Week 2, 12, 24, and 48 | Change from baseline in FeNO at Weeks 2, 12, 24, and 48, where a participant experiencing ICEs in categories 5 or 6 after treatment initiation and prior to Week 48 is considered to have zero change from baseline in FeNO at Weeks 2, 12, 24, and 48 will be reported. FeNO is a non-invasive breath test that provides an objective measure of type 2 airway inflammation. High FeNO levels have been shown to predict increased risk of acute exacerbations in participants with moderate to severe asthma. |
| Change From Baseline in Asthma Control Questionnaire, 5-item (ACQ-5) At Week 48 | Baseline, Week 48 | Change from baseline in ACQ-5 at Week 48, where a participant experiencing ICEs in categories 5 or 6 after treatment initiation and prior to Week 48 is considered to have zero change from baseline will be reported. The ACQ is a validated, 5-item, patient-reported tool used to measure asthma control and treatment effectiveness over the past week. Each item has with 7 response categories ranging from 0 to 6. The ACQ-5 is scored by computing the average of the 5 items. The final score ranges from 0 (well-controlled) to 6 (extremely poorly controlled). |
| Mean Change From Baseline in the 7-Day Mean Daily Asthma Daily Diary score at Week 48 | Baseline, Week 48 | Mean change from baseline in the 7-day mean daily asthma daily diary score at Week 48 will be reported. A participant experiencing ICEs in categories 5 or 6 after treatment initiation and prior to Week 48 is considered to have zero change from baseline. |
| Number of Participants With Adverse Events (AEs) and Serious Adverse Events (SAEs) | Up to 90 weeks | An AE is any untoward medical occurrence in a clinical trial participant administered a pharmaceutical (investigational or non-investigational) product. An AE does not necessarily have a causal relationship with the intervention. SAE is any untoward medical occurrence that, at any dose: results in death; is life-threatening; requires inpatient hospitalization or prolongation of existing hospitalization, except: hospitalizations not intended to treat an acute illness or AE; results in persistent or significant disability/incapacity; is a congenital anomaly/birth defect; is a suspected transmission of any infectious agent via a medicinal product; is medically important. |
